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
MySQL на примерах.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В. C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В. PHP 5. На примерах. Авторы: Кузнецов М.В., Симдянов И.В., Голышев С.В. PHP. Практика создания Web-сайтов (второе издание).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

HTML+CSS+JavaScript

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: форма: деактивация полей по чекбоксу
 
 автор: denvor   (24.10.2005 в 14:36)   письмо автору
 
 

Необходимо реализовать затенение (невозможность редактирования) набора полей (чекбоксы, текстовые поля) в форме при отметке чекбокса. И снятие затенения при снятии отметки.

Я помню, что затеняемые элементы должны группироваться, но не помню как и что должно происходить дальше. Помогите, плиз!

   
 
 автор: 12345   (24.10.2005 в 15:28)   письмо автору
 
   для: denvor   (24.10.2005 в 14:36)
 

http://softtime.ru/forum/read.php?id_forum=4&id_theme=8166&page=1

   
 
 автор: denvor   (24.10.2005 в 16:53)   письмо автору
 
   для: 12345   (24.10.2005 в 15:28)
 

спасибо! А как все-таки сгруппировать элементы формы, чтобы всем присвоить disabled ? Можно , как я понял, прописать им класс, но вроде есть какой-то способ группировки полей?

   
 
 автор: 12345   (24.10.2005 в 17:04)   письмо автору
 
   для: denvor   (24.10.2005 в 16:53)
 

Группировка с помощью тега fieldset есть способ визуализации группировки (http://www.htmlbook.ru/html/?id=28), а для JS классы - естественная группировка. Ещё можно объектам input свойства присвоить, тогда одному объекту приписывается сколько угодно свойств. (
<input id=ee size=10 disab=1 prop1=1200 prop2=100 ... > ... if(document.all.ee.disab)document.all.ee.disabled=true;
) Как это во всех браузерах работает - не знаю, но можно эти "disab" вписывать в JS, тогда будет полностью корректно.

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ования